The staff is thoroughly trained and managers bring allergies to the table. They even use a black napkin under allergy plates as a signal to all employees that the dish is an allergy. They use casarecce GF pasta - so they can know it’s GF just by looking at it. I felt incredibly safe eating here, and I got an almond flour cannoli!

Came in around 7 pm on a Saturday night and got a table for 3 right away! It is not too fancy and I would describe it as more of an upscale casual restaurant. As a gluten free person, this restaurant has tons of options and all of the fried foods are already made naturally gf so there’s plenty of dishes to choose from. They also gave me gluten free dinner rolls when they brought the bread by!
I ordered the lobster roll and had it on a gluten free bun (you can also ask for a lettuce wrap). The waitress felt like my gf lobster roll looked smaller than my brother’s regular lobster roll (even though they said they weigh out each portion), so they brought me an extra portion of lobster to make up for it!
